Output 764466c896d7357812bd48d77acc560bfc459f0abb34a9b27c900a9fc26bc1b8:19

value
25872
script pubkey
OP_0 OP_PUSHBYTES_20 1f6def5f16134c7737f31e2f020ea90a100c3a43
address
bc1qrak77hckzdx8wdlnrchsyr4fpggqcwjr9t2uhc
transaction
764466c896d7357812bd48d77acc560bfc459f0abb34a9b27c900a9fc26bc1b8
spent
true